  7. OK, I figured it out. The file wasn't loading when I dragged and dropped it into Squarespace, but when I navigated to it directly, it was able to load it. I also needed to extract it from the zipped file before Squarespace could find it (even though I was able to see the font in my folder structure and install it on my computer without unzipping it).
